若输入tc,则程序的运行结果为【 】。 include <stdio.h> main() { char str[40]; fscanf(st
若输入tc,则程序的运行结果为【 】。 include <stdio.h> main() { char str[40]; fscanf(stdin,"%s",str); fprintf(stdout,"%s\n",str); }
若输入tc,则程序的运行结果为【 】。 include <stdio.h> main() { char str[40]; fscanf(stdin,"%s",str); fprintf(stdout,"%s\n",str); }
第1题
下列程序的运行结果为【 】。 main() { int i; char a[]="I love china!",b[20],*p1,*p2; p1=a; p2=b; while(*p1) { *p2=*p1; p1++; p2++; } *p2=\0; printf("string b is: %s\n",b); }
请帮忙给出正确答案和分析,谢谢!
第2题
如果输入1、2、3、4,则以下程序的运行结果为【 】。 include <stdio.h> main() { char c; int i,k; k=0; for (i=0;i<4;i++) { while(1) { c=getchar(); if(c>=0&&c<=9) break; } k=k*10+c-0; } printf("k=%d\n",k); }
请帮忙给出正确答案和分析,谢谢!
第3题
设有以下结构类型说明和变量定义,则变量a在内存所占字节数是【 】。 struct stud { char num[6]; int s[4]; double ave; } a,*p;
请帮忙给出正确答案和分析,谢谢!
第4题
若有以下定义语句,则不移动指针p,并且通过指针p引用值为98的数组元素的表达式是【 】。 int w[10]={23,54,10,33,47,98,72,80,61},*p=w;
请帮忙给出正确答案和分析,谢谢!
为了保护您的账号安全,请在“上学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!